Here's how you can make this delicious treat at home:

Ingredients

 1/2 cup granulated sugar

 1/3 cup salted butter (melted)

 1 1/2 tablespoons red food colouring

 1/2 teaspoon salt

 2 1/3 cups all-purpose flour

 2 cups of milk

 2 tablespoons white vinegar

 2 teaspoons baking powder

 1/2 teaspoon baking soda

 2 large eggs

 2 teaspoons vanilla extract

 3 tablespoons cocoa powder

 For garnish (optional): fresh raspberries and mint leaves

For the cream cheese glaze:

 a third of a cup of milk

 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ract

 6 tablespoons softened butter

 2 cups powdered sugar

 170 g cream cheese (softened) 

Method:

 A non-stick electric griddle should be preheated to 350 degrees. Flour, cocoa powder, baking powder, baking soda, and salt should all be combined in a mixing bowl before setting it aside. Pour the milk into a liquid measuring cup, add the vinegar, and whisk. Let the mixture sit for two minutes.

 Add sugar, eggs, red food colouring, vanilla, and melted butter to the milk mixture in a separate, large mixing bowl. Stir the mixture thoroughly. Add the dry ingredients gradually while whisking, then blend just until combined.

 Depending on the size of your pancakes, add 1/4 to 1/3 cup of batter at a time to the heated griddle.

 Pancakes should be cooked until bubbles appear on the top surface before flipping and continuing to cook on the other side.

 Garnish with fresh raspberries and mint leaves, if desired, and serve warm with a cream cheese glaze.

 For the cream cheese glaze, combine the cream cheese and butter in a mixing bowl and beat with an electric hand mixer on medium speed until well combined and frothy, about 2 minutes.

 Then add the remaining ingredients and whisk everything together for approximately a minute; if needed, add more milk to thin it out. Keep it in the refrigerator in an airtight container.
